  • Abstract
    Oxidation of some benzoins to benziles is reported by using p-toluenesulfonic acid as a selective oxidation catalyst under solvent-free condition in high yield. The adjacent carbonyl group is necessary for the oxidation of hydroxyl group in these compounds. The reaction is carried out in a sand-bath at 100 °C with minimum by-products.
